There's nothing quite like walking in the woods on a winter night to appreciate the wonder of winter. As nature sleeps, the frozen landscape is still and silent. Shades of muted light cast shadows on the snow, altering one's perception of objects, both familiar and unfamiliar. The woods on a winter's night are full of surprises too -- the other night while locking up our chickens, I heard a pair of owls at opposite ends of the estate communicate to each other in the frozen air.
